1. Know Your Platform

One of the first steps in engaging in online sports communities is understanding the platform you are using. Whether it’s Twitter, Reddit, Discord, Facebook teams, or dedicated boards like RealGM or SB Nation, each platform has its own tradition, norms, and guidelines of interactment.

As an illustration, Twitter thrives on quick, sharp takes and rapid reactions. Reddit’s r/sports or r/NBA communities might worth more in-depth discussions with a thread structure that encourages back-and-forth dialogue. Discord servers may foster a more intimate group dynamic, with real-time chat rooms centered around particular teams or events. Before diving in, take a while to look at how folks work together and the unwritten etiquette that guides the conversation.

3. Be Respectful, Even in Disagreements

Sports could be highly emotional, and disagreements are inevitable when passionate fans gather. Nevertheless, it’s essential to remain respectful, even when the conversation gets heated. Avoid personal attacks, name-calling, or inflammatory language. Instead, focus on the substance of the talk—why you disagree with someone’s take, backed by info or insights.

Keep in mind that at the end of the day, everyone in the community shares a common love for the sport. Sustaining a respectful tone keeps the conversation constructive and ensures that you just build a popularity as somebody whose opinions are price considering. Additionally, respect extends beyond just direct interactions with others. Be mindful of broader topics like race, gender, and inclusion when discussing athletes and teams. Online sports communities, like any social space, should be welcoming for all.

4. Contribute Positively to the Dialogue

Positive contributions don’t just mean cheering to your team or offering reward when things go well. It means bringing insights, asking thoughtful questions, and offering different perspectives. Interact with other users by acknowledging their points, expanding on them, or politely challenging them with new ideas.

For instance, instead of simply stating, “Player X is overrated,” provide some context. Perhaps focus on how Player X’s stats don’t hold up in opposition to different top performers within the league or highlight specific games the place they’ve underperformed. Quality contributions add worth to the discussion and assist elevate the overall conversation, making the community a better place for everyone.
